Let the weight of box A to be a, of box B to be b and of box C to be c.
Box B is {{{3&1/2}}} kg more than box A means {{{b=a+3&1/2}}}.
Box C weighs {{{5&1/3}}} kg more than Box B means {{{c=b+5&1/3}}}.
The total weight of three boxes is {{{60&1/2}}} kg means {{{a+b+c=60&1/2}}}.
{{{a+b+c=60&1/2}}} --> Equation 1
{{{b=a+3&1/2}}}
{{{a=b-3&1/2}}} --> Equation 2 ... Substitute {{{a=b-3&1/2}}} into Equation 1
{{{c=b+5&1/3}}} --> Equation 3 ... Substitute {{{c=b+5&1/3}}} into Equation 1
{{{a+b+c=60&1/2}}}
{{{(b-3&1/2)+b+(b+5&1/3)=60&1/2}}}
{{{b-3&1/2+b+b+5&1/3=60&1/2}}}
{{{b+b+b-3&1/2+5&1/3=60&1/2}}}
{{{3b-3&1/2+5&1/3=60&1/2}}}
{{{3b+1&5/6=60&1/2}}}
{{{3b=60&1/2-1&5/6}}}
{{{3b=58&2/3}}}
{{{3b=176/3}}}
{{{cross(3)b/cross(3)=(176/3)/3}}}
{{{b=(176/3)*(1/3)}}}
{{{b=176/9}}}
{{{b=19&5/9}}} ... Substitute {{{b=19&5/9}}} into Equation 2
{{{a=b-3&1/2}}}
{{{a=19&5/9-3&1/2}}}
{{{a=16&1/18}}}
Therefore, the weight of box A is {{{16&1/18}}} kg.
